#0f6b94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f6b94 is composed of 5.9% red, 42%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.9% cyan, 27.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 198.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 32%. #0f6b94 color hex could be obtained by blending #1ed6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#0f6b94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f6b94 has RGB values of R:15, G:107,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 1010580.

Shades and Tints of #0f6b94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010406 is the darkest color, while #f3f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0f6b94
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5355 is the less saturated color, while #0270a1 is the most saturated one.
